pRb's role in cell fate, lineage commitment, and tumorigenesis
The product of the retinoblastoma gene, pRB, was the first known and cloned tumor suppressor gene and it is functionally inactivated in most human cancers. pRB is thought to suppresses tumorigenesis by restraining cellular proliferation. pRB binds to the E2F family of transcription factors and …

The roles of Rb, p107, and E2f4 in bone formation and embryonic development
… we analyze the in vivo roles of three proteins, pRb, E2F4, and p107, in murine embryonic development and in differentiation in vitro. As Rb loss causes embryonic lethality due to placental defects, we adopted a conditional knockout strategy to generate Rb-deficient embryos that survive to birth. …

Rb pathway and chromatin remodeling genes that antagonize let-60 Ras signaling during C. elegans vulval development
… encodes a protein similar to the mammalian pRb tumor suppressor protein. The LIN-35 Rb protein is proposed to act with HDA-1, a histone deacetylase homolog with class B synMuv activity, to remodel chromatin and repress transcription of genes that promote vulval development. To further …
